Yuqin Cai is a scholar working on Molecular Biology, Cancer Research and Genetics. According to data from OpenAlex, Yuqin Cai has authored 31 papers receiving a total of 810 ind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Molecular Biology, 4 papers in Cancer Research and 3 papers in Genetics. Recurrent topics in Yuqin Cai's work include DNA and Nucleic Acid Chemistry (23 papers), DNA Repair Mechanisms (22 papers) and RNA and protein synthesis mechanisms (6 papers). Yuqin Cai is often cited by papers focused on DNA and Nucleic Acid Chemistry (23 papers), DNA Repair Mechanisms (22 papers) and RNA and protein synthesis mechanisms (6 papers). Yuqin Cai collaborates with scholars based in United States, China and United Kingdom. Yuqin Cai's co-authors include Suse Broyde, Nicholas E. Geacintov, Konstantin Kropachev, Dinshaw J. Patel, Marina Kolbanovskiy, Alexander Kolbanovskiy, Shantu Amin, Shuang Ding, Shuang Ding and Zhi Liu and has published in prestigious journals such as Nucleic Acids Research, The EMBO Journal and Journal of Molecular Biology.
